1. The Trust Fund for Administering and Meeting the Objectives of the Framework Convention on the Protection and Sustainable Development of the Carpathians and related Protocols (hereinafter referred to as the Carpathian Convention and related protocols) including the functioning of the Secretariat (hereinafter referred to as the Trust Fund) is established for an initial period of three years, to provide financial support for the implementation of the Program of Work (POW) of the Convention and the functioning of the Secretariat.
2. The administration of the Trust Fund shall be entrusted to the Secretary-General of the United Nations and, at his discretion to the Executive Director of UNEP under the relevant financial rules and regulations of the United Nations as well as the general procedures governing the operations of the Fund of UNEP, taking into account the Financial Rules for the administration of the Trust Fund of the Carpathian Convention and related protocols, adopted at the first Meeting of the Conference of Parties. The Executive Director can delegate the administration of the Trust Fund to the Head of the Secretariat of the Carpathian Convention and related protocols.
3. The Trust Fund shall be used for funding the implementation of the Program of Work (POW) of the Convention and the functioning of its Secretariat; its budget will be composed of two sections to cover the expenditures under the following categories:
Section I: Assessed contributions for Administering and Meeting the Objectives of the Convention and related Protocols, including the functioning of the Secretariat.
Section II: (Additional) voluntary contributions for Administering and Meeting the Objectives of the Convention and related Protocols, including the functioning of the Secretariat.
4. The appropriation of section I shall be composed of:
(Assessed) Annual contributions from the Contracting Parties.
5. The appropriation of section II shall be composed of:
Additional voluntary contributions from the Contracting Parties
Contributions from Governments which are not Contracting Parties, governmental, intergovernmental and non-governmental organizations and programs, and the private sector.
6. The (assessed) annual contributions from the Contracting Parties for Administering and Meeting the Objectives of the Convention and related Protocols, including the functioning of the Secretariat will for each of the Contracting Parties consist of a share of the budget for Section I of the Trust Fund, to be determined by the Conference of the Parties (COP); the contributions shall be due on 1 January of each calendar year.
7. Voluntary (additional) contributions for Administering and Meeting the Objectives of the Convention and related Protocols, including the functioning of the Secretariat may be pledged and made at any time. They shall be used in accordance with the terms and conditions agreed between the Head of the Secretariat and the respective contributor.
8. The financial period shall be for three calendar years beginning 1 January of the first year and ending 31 December of the third calendar year.
9. The budget estimates, covering the income and expenditures for the financial period to which they relate, prepared in US dollars, shall be submitted to and approved by the Conference of the Parties to the Carpathian Convention and related protocols.
10. The estimates for each of the calendar years covered by the financial period shall be divided into sections and chapters as shown in the appendix to this terms of reference, shall be specified according to budget lines, shall include references to the program of work to which they relate, and shall be accompanied by any further information as the Executive Director of UNEP may deem useful and advisable.
11. The Head of the Secretariat may commit resources against the Trust Fund only if such commitments are covered by contributions already received. In the event that the Executive Director anticipates that there might be a shortfall in resources over the financial period as a whole, he shall notify the Head of Secretariat, who shall adjust the budget so that expenditures are at all times fully covered by contributions received.
12. The Executive Director of UNEP on the advice of the Head of the Secretariat may make transfers from one section/budget line to another. At the end of the first calendar year of a financial period, the Executive Director may proceed to transfer any uncommitted balance of appropriations, to the same section in the second calendar year.
13. It is for the Conference of the Parties and UNEP to agree on an administrative support charge to be paid to UNEP3.
14. At the end of each calendar year, the Executive Director of UNEP shall submit to the Contracting Parties, through the Head of the Secretariat, the certified accounts for that year. At the close of the financial period, he shall submit to them the audited accounts for the financial period.
15. The Trust Fund shall be subjected to external auditing, as decided by the COP and in accordance with the rules and regulations of the United Nations.
16. The Executive Director of UNEP shall prepare a report on the budget implementation and submit it to the Contracting Parties at least 6 weeks before the date of each ordinary meeting of the COP.
17. In the event that the COP decides to terminate the Trust Fund, a notification to that effect shall be presented to UNEP at least six months before the date of termination selected by the COP. The COP shall decide, in consultation with UNEP, on the distribution of any unspent balance after all liquidation expenses have been met.
These terms of reference shall be effective from the date of their approval by the Contracting Parties.
